Pick n Pay and FNB have launched an exclusive new deal, giving customers everything they need to make four cheeseburgers at home for just R50—a cost-effective R12.50 per burger.

Available every Friday, the deal is designed to help South Africans enjoy quality, affordable meals at home at a time when budgets are under increasing pressure. Typically priced at R150, customers who swipe their registered Smart Shopper card and pay with their FNB card in-store will pay just R50 for five ingredients to make a classic burger. If customers only swipe their registered Smart Shopper card, the price is R100.

“We’re making it easier for families to enjoy a delicious homemade meal at an unbeatable price. This deal is about making family mealtimes more convenient and affordable while still delivering on taste and quality," says Peter Arnold, Pick n Pay: Executive Commercial Fresh.

This is the latest in a series of value-driven offers from Pick n Pay and FNB’s newly launched ‘Iconic Duo’ partnership, which saw Pick n Pay become the primary grocery partner in FNB’s eBucks programme this week. Pick n Pay and FNB have previously collaborated on initiatives such as the 99c bread offer, which saw 400,000 vouchers issued to FNB Easy customers in December 2024 alone.

The partnership will also bring more innovative savings initiatives to customers over the coming months. "We know our customers are always looking for more ways to save on groceries, and this is just the beginning of what we have planned," adds Arnold.

The Burger Friday deal includes five ingredients: a choice of PnP Burger Patties 4s (Beef/Boerie/Cheese/Pepper), PnP Bakery Buns (4s), Lettuce Mix (80g), Slicing Tomatoes (2s), and Lancewood Processed Cheese Slices (175g).

With four different patty options, customers can try a different burger combination each week.

“The deal is designed to be a great meal on its own, but with the savings, customers can easily add extra toppings and create a more gourmet burger experience at home," says Arnold.

The Burger Friday deal launches on 4 April 2025 and will be available every Friday, with a limit of three deals per customer per week.
